I've been editing games for quite some time and now i'm gonna start doing CoH2 in-game edits! Here's my first... (Not one of my best edits, honestly it's quite crappy)



-If the text on the right is too small, it says: The Royal Canadian Armed forces will send Canadian Riflemen instead of the British Infantry Sections. These units have less training than Infantry Sections, can build everything Royal Engineers can't, are more motivated in battle and have 6 man squads.

My idea is that those Commanders of the commonwealth (Canada, Australia, etc) would be rarer than British commanders, but would have different units(with different stats too!) and a tiny bit different models (Maybe even different passives and voice lines!).
